A Career on the Line

Vinny Nittoli, a 35-year-old veteran, finds himself at a crossroads. With a decade-long career spanning 12 organizations, he has experienced the highs and lows of professional baseball. His journey has taken him through the ranks of five MLB teams, with a career-high of seven appearances for the Athletics in 2024. Despite these achievements, Nittoli is now facing a decision that could define the remainder of his playing days.

The Elbow Injury

Nittoli has been diagnosed with ligament damage in his elbow, a common and often career-altering injury for pitchers. The right-hander is considering two surgical options: Tommy John surgery or an internal brace procedure. Both are serious interventions, and the choice will likely determine the outcome of his season and potentially his entire career.

A Season in Limbo

Currently a non-roster invitee, Nittoli's future with the Red Sox is uncertain. He signed a minor league contract last month and made three spring appearances, but elbow discomfort during his most recent outing has raised concerns. Manager Alex Cora confirmed the team is awaiting imaging results, and the news is not looking promising for the veteran reliever.

A Career Retrospective

Nittoli's career has been a testament to perseverance. Drafted in the 25th round, he has spent six seasons at the Triple-A level, showcasing a strong strikeout rate of 28.3% across 223 innings. Last year, he combined for a 4.58 ERA with a 26% strikeout percentage and an 8% walk rate between Baltimore's and Milwaukee's top affiliates.
